How you can give your Accountant, Bookkeeper or Tax agent access to your company payroll in Payroller

Learn how you can give your Accountant, Bookkeeper, or Tax agent access to your payroll in Payroller with our simple guide below.

If you are having trouble inviting your agent, check out our troubleshooting guide below.

If you’re an employer using Payroller, you might want to give your accountant/bookkeeper/ tax agent access to your payroll.

There are two ways to invite your agent

  • Invite via the ‘Invite Accountant’ button

  • Invite via ‘Settings’

Please note that you will only be able to connect your Payroller account with one accountant at a time. If you are changing accountants please make sure to unlink your agent and invite another.


Invite via the ‘Invite Accountant’ button

 

Step 1: Click on the ‘Invite Accountant’ button.

Registering Your Account - Invite your Agent - 1

Step 2: Enter the email of your accountant/bookkeeper/tax agent

A pop-up will appear. Enter the email address of your Agent and press ‘Send Invitation’.

Registering Your Account - Invite your Agent - 2

Your accountant/bookkeeper/tax agent will be sent an email with a link for them to click on which will allow them to access your payroll data.

Your accountant/bookkeeper/tax agent will need to accept this invitation within a certain time frame. If the link has expired by the time they click on it, just follow the same steps as before to resend it.

If your accountant/bookkeeper/tax agent doesn’t receive this email, ask them to check their spam or junk folder. If it still can’t be found, reach out to us at hello@payroller.com.au or the support chat for assistance.

Invite via Organisation settings

 

Step 1: Go to ‘Settings’.

Registering Your Account - Invite your Agent - 4

Step 2: Select ‘Organisation Settings’.

Registering Your Account - Invite your Agent - 5

Step 3: Select ‘Linked agent’.

Registering Your Account - Invite your Agent - 6

Step 4: Select ‘Link an agent’.

Registering Your Account - Invite your Agent - 7

Step 5: Enter your agent’s email address

Then, select ‘Send invitation’.

Registering Your Account - Invite your Agent - 8

Your agent should have now received the invitation to connect. They will need to accept the invitation and login if they have an account or register if they do not have a Payroller account.

Registering Your Account - Invite your Agent - 9

Your accountant/bookkeeper/tax agent will need to accept this invitation within a certain time frame. If the link has expired by the time they click on it, just follow the same steps as before to resend it.

Having trouble inviting your agent to connect?

If you cannot see the invite accountant button this could be due to one of three reasons

  1. Your screen resolution may be preventing you from seeing the option

  2. You may have already connected your agent

  3. You may have changed your client account to an agent account.


Screen resolution

To troubleshoot the first case, zoom out of the screen by selecting ctrl – on PC OR command – on Mac. If you have done so and you cannot see the invite accountant on the left side then follow the next step.

Registering Your Account - Invite your Agent - 10

Already connected agent

To review the second case, go to settings > Organisation settings > Linked agent and check to see if you have an agent connected. If you already have an agent connected and you would like to change the agent connected

Registering Your Account - Invite your Agent - 11

Accidentally changed the client account to an agent account

If you don’t have these options available and your screen looks like the following you may have accidentally changed your account to an agent account you can change this back by following this guide.
